手机版

vue自动路由实现代码

时间:2021-08-19 来源:互联网 编辑:宝哥软件园 浏览:

目的

解放你的双手,永远不要配置路线。当你看到项目中大量的路线是拆分维护业务路线还是统一门户维护时,不用担心。router-auto是您的最佳选择,它可以帮助您解决路由的维护成本。您只需要创建相应的文件夹,就可以动态生成路由。可以在main.js中截取路由,比你想象的要简单。

路由器-自动github地址很有帮助,你可以启动它。

路由器自动npm地址欢迎提及问题的影响

简要用法

具体用法请实时查看github或npm。以下是一些简单的用法介绍

引用

Const router auto=需要(' router-auto ')模块。exports={entry: ' . ',output3360 {},module: {},plugin3360 [new router auto ()]}项目结构

Package.json和其他文件和目录src项目目录

页面目录helloworld Index.vue页面条目hello.vue业务组件router.js另外配置demo test Index.vue页面条目test.vue业务组件Index.vue页面条目home Index.vue页面条目页面条目上方的目录结构生成路由结构如下

从“vue”导入Vue从“vue-router”导入Router从“@/page/helloworld/Index”导入hello world . Vue从“@/page/demo/index . Vue“import demo _ test from”@/page/demo/test/index . Vue“import home from”@/page/home/index . Vue . use(Router)导出默认的新Router({ mode:'history ',base:'/auto/',routes:

参数描述类型默认值必需contentBase根目录,即src水平目录String当前根目录进程. cwd()模式中无模式字符串历史记录路由器中无基本字符串/自动/无观察器是否启用热更新(请在开发环境中启用)Boolean false无小缺陷

首先,我们的项目不需要子路线,所以都是平铺路线,但是你可以在文件夹中创建一个文件夹来规划子路线,然后升级几个版本来加入。当然,看看用法和需求,伪需求会切断磁盘上生成的router.js文件。作者会进一步优化,放到记忆里,一步一步,创造大好河山,然后就不会有瑕疵了.我希望提到的问题越多,这篇文章的参考和相关内容地址就越好

电子邮件[emailprotected]github进来点击star,作者给你什么!发布一切原因必须有结果,你的报应是我的nuxt源代码参考

以上就是本文的全部内容。希望对大家的学习有帮助,支持我们。

版权声明:vue自动路由实现代码是由宝哥软件园云端程序自动收集整理而来。如果本文侵犯了你的权益,请联系本站底部QQ或者邮箱删除。